Definition
"Barebacked" is very similar to "bareback," meaning without a saddle when riding a horse. It can also describe someone without a shirt or top. Think of a cowboy riding a horse without a saddle, feeling the animal's power beneath him 🤠. It suggests a lack of protection and direct contact. It is often considered a more descriptive adjective than the adverbial form. It is equally useful to describe a shirtless person.
